For those moving from Tempe to Phoenix, you'll find reassuring similarities in neighborhood vibes and lifestyles, facilitating a smoother transition. For example, Maple-Ash's walkability and historic homes find a match in Willo, where every street tells a story, adorned with historic preservation plaques. Arcadia, resembling Tempe Gardens, is famed for its verdant landscapes and post-war ranch homes, offering a bubbly blend of urban and suburban with spots like La Grande Orange Grocery & Pizzeria that magnetize locals and visitors alike. Roosevelt Row's eclectic mix of art galleries, murals, and vibrant community events offers an artsy vibe similar to Meyer Park but with a more pronounced urban edge. Transitioning individuals and families can find comfort in these familiar but uniquely Phoenix neighborhoods.

Moving from the college-centered city of Tempe to the bustling metropolitan area of Phoenix offers a variety of changes in scenery and lifestyle. Phoenix, with its expansive offerings, boasts a larger job market and a diverse array of nightlife options such as Blue Ribbon Army for your social calendar. Although the cost of living may see an uptick in Phoenix, the trade-off includes access to renowned restaurants like Pizzeria Bianco and sights like the Desert Botanical Garden. On the flip side, Tempe's charm lies in its college town feel, offering a youthful vibe and more affordable living, though it may lack the vast job opportunities and the demographic diversity of Phoenix. Considering aspects such as neighborhood parks, the availability of amenities, and the overall atmosphere are crucial in assessing what fits best with your lifestyle and aspirations.

Pet-friendly Neighborhoods in Phoenix, AZ

1. Midtown Phoenix: Known for its walkable streets and numerous pet-friendly patios, your furry friends will love the welcoming atmosphere and Rosie McCaffrey’s Irish Pub for a bite where pets are happily seen on the patio.

2. Arcadia: This neighborhood is a paradise for pets with spacious backyards and close proximity to Camelback Mountain for adventurous walks and hikes, making it perfect for active dogs.

3. Roosevelt Row: This artsy district not only welcomes pets in many galleries and cafes but also hosts pet-centric events like the annual Phoestivus market, making it an incredibly fun and engaging community for pet lovers.

In Tempe, you'll find a political environment that tends to lean Democratic with a particular emphasis on progressive policies, especially concerning environmental sustainability. The religious landscape is notably diverse, allowing for a wide range of faith communities, including sizable Muslim populations linked to local mosques. Moving to Phoenix, the political scene remains predominantly Democratic, but with a more varied mix across districts. The religious composition in Phoenix is similarly diverse but with a stronger presence of major Christian denominations such as Catholic and Baptist, reflecting in part the larger size and demographic variety of the city. While Phoenix generally experiences slightly higher traffic congestion and longer average commute times, Tempe offers slightly better public transit options, making it a bit more feasible for residents to get around without a car. However, both cities pose challenges for those opting to live without a vehicle, indicating the importance of proximity to work, amenities, and public transit services. Whether considering the light rail in Phoenix or the dense bike lanes in Tempe, evaluating your daily travel needs will be key in adapting to your new environment.
